Manchester United's most creative players this season may surprise supporters

Manchester United should be counting down the days until Paul Pogba returns from injury - according to this season's statistics.

United lie seventh in the Premier League table, winning just four of their opening 12 fixtures.

The midfielder has featured in just five of those games, registering two assists against Chelsea, prior to the loss against Crystal Palace.

United fans have bemoaned the lack of creativity in the side at various points of the season - Andreas Pereira's dismal showing during the defeat against Bournemouth highlighted a major problem that Ole Gunnar Solskjaer needs to solve.

Pogba has been pencilled in for a return in December and stats suggest his return could be just what United need to get back into top four contention.

United have created 133 chances in the Premier League so far, the fourth highest total in the league. Leading the way in chance creation for the Reds is defender Ashley Young (18) followed by Pereira (17) as per Bein Sports.

A chance is a pass that leads to a shot. Therefore, it's no surprise to see both players top the table given they are United's designated corner takers.

Pogba ranks fourth on the list with 13 chances created, not factoring in his two assists on the opening day of the season. Given the amount of games he has missed and his deeper position this season, his position on the list showcases just how important he is to United scoring goals.

Fred and Scott McTominay have formed a decent partnership in the deep two man midfield pivot which would allow Pogba free reign ahead of them.

In a more advanced central attacking midfield position, stats suggest the Frenchman will thrive.

Pogba has averaged more key passes than any United player this season and his best games in a red shirt have came from the No.10 role.

With Marcus Rashford and Anthony Martial starting to hit form, the World Cup winner could be the final piece of the puzzle.
